原因是我定義了一個二維數組
int e[510][510];
而在使用fill對數組初始化時,並沒有采用二維數組初始化的方式,而是寫成了:
fill(e, e + 510 * 510, inf);
正確寫法應該是:
fill(e[0], e[0] + 510 * 510, inf);
原因是我定義了一個二維數組
int e[510][510];
而在使用fill對數組初始化時,並沒有采用二維數組初始化的方式,而是寫成了:
fill(e, e + 510 * 510, inf);
正確寫法應該是:
fill(e[0], e[0] + 510 * 510, inf);
本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。